5. Theory of Logic / F. Referring in Logic / 3. Property (λ-) Abstraction
'Predicate abstraction' abstracts predicates from formulae, giving scope for constants and functions [Fitting/Mendelsohn]
     Full Idea: 'Predicate abstraction' is a key idea. It is a syntactic mechanism for abstracting a predicate from a formula, providing a scoping mechanism for constants and function symbols similar to that provided for variables by quantifiers.
     From: M Fitting/R Mendelsohn (First-Order Modal Logic [1998], Pref)
5. Theory of Logic / K. Features of Logics / 1. Axiomatisation
Axioms reveal the underlying assumptions, and reveal relationships between different areas [Kline]
     Full Idea: The axiomatic method ....revealed precisely what assumptions underlie each branch [of mathematics] and made possible the comparison and clarification of the relationships of various branches.
     From: Morris Kline (Mathematical Thought from Ancient to Modern Times [1972], p.1027), quoted by Penelope Maddy - Defending the Axioms 1.3
     A reaction: I take this to be the 'fruitfulness' which marks out the discovery of the essence of something.
